While uPVC is a great option for new windows It is essential to consider the installation costs when choosing a contractor. Cheaper off-the-shelf windows are often not the best fit and must be fitted using excessive expanding foam, which can result in damp, drafts, and reduce the life of your new windows. uPVC is also susceptible to warping if not installed properly.
